I dont know about the cloneBD method, but here is the one i use and that work.
Exemple : To make a DV version of Alita Battle Angel, with French and English audio.

1/ BDinfo => to scan for the m2ts files that you have to join to demux the ISO/BDMV
Image

2/ tsMuxeR GUI 2.6.12 => to demux the tracks you want
Image

note:
At the end of the demux stage and to make it easier, i rename the files:
- for the HDR10 => bl.hevc
- for the DV layer => el.hevc
- the french audio => audio_fr.dts
- and english audio => audio_en.ac3

For the english track, i directly downconvert TrueHD to ac3, so there is no more work to do on english file.
So now i have: audio_fr.dts and audio_en.ac3

3/ eac3to => to convert audio file to codec supported by mp4 (e-ac3 or ac3)
As the audio_fr file is in dts, i need to convert it to ac3.

Code: Select all

eac3to.exe audio_fr.dts audio.ac3 -core -640
Image

4/ mp4muxer_64bits => to make the DV mp4 file
Now, all the files are in a format supported by the mp4 container.
I can make the DV mp4 file.

Code: Select all

mp4muxer_64bits.exe --dv-profile 7 -i bl.hevc -i el.hevc -i audio_fr.ac3 --media-lang fre -i audio_en.ac3 --media-lang eng -o DV-Movie.mp4
Image

note:
At the end you can rename the DV-Movie.mp4 file. For exemple, Alita, Battle Angel [FR ac3][EN ac3][4k][DV].mp4 :wink:

First audio track will be played by default.
On LG C7, when you select the second track, you lose the sound (LG bug?), but if you go back 15 seconds, then it works and you have the sound of the second track.

mp4 also supports non-atmos 7.1 ALAC (Apple Lossless Audio Codec). if you want the keep the original ~7mbps audio (minus atmos) and get Dolby Vision at the same time it's pretty simple; True-HD / DTS-HD MA --> PCM 7.1 --> ALAC. obviously Apple TV 4k (and LG OLED's) support it just fine, not sure of all the specific models, though.

OK, I figured out the problem totally. I have no idea how LG and Vizio TVs are doing Profile 7, but TVs are only supposed to support dvhe.04.07/dvhe.05.07 while UHD BD players can do dvhe.07.06/dvhe.07.07 which is what is mentioned in this thread. When I used dv-profile 5 instead of 7, it worked perfectly on my TCL Roku 4K TV and still retained 12 bit color info as it had two streams.

It's because the mkv container only supports elementary stream playback, so a dual layer dv mkv will disregard the enhancement layer. the Matroska team is currently working on an update that sees the second stream. if you could put a single layer DV stream (like the LG Demo .ts or DVDFab .mp4 files) into an mkv without losing the rpu data it would play in DV on any device that already supports dvhe and you'd get the benefit of full hd-audio. that's the problem right now though; there's no software to rip single layer to DV or convert single layer mp4 to mkv without losing rpu metadata and reverting back to just main.10 hdr :/

Maybe because Dolby said so? It is not so simple as profile 5 not having dual layer support. Profile 5 can certainly have two layers but a PQ function is used. Profile 4 supports EL but at a lower resolution. It is not "Netflix DV" because there's still two 10-bit layers combined by the TV either with EL or PQ to create 12 Bit Dolby Vision. Streaming is 10 bit and is a completely different spec.

This is right.
But it simply means that a television needs to support dvhe.04.07 and dvhe.05.07 to be Dolby Vision certified.
And nothing prevents a manufacturer to go further and allow his television to read the dvhe.07.

This is what makes the différence between LG, Vizio (dvhe.07 dual layer compatible) and Sony, Panasonic, Philips, TCL (dvhe.05 single layer compatible) :mrgreen:

from Annexe II
"If a Dolby Vision playback device supports Dolby Vision profile 7, it can check for these values in
the reference processing unit of a Dolby Vision bitstream. If the values are not exactly as shown
for all three channels, the device can flag the bitstream as a Dolby Vision profile 7 full
enhancement layer bitstream; otherwise, flag the bitstream as profile 7 MEL."

The documentation don't say "if a BD UHD player (which, for you, should be the only device to support dvhe.07) ..." but instead Dolby wrote "if a playback device".
This mean it can be any device, a bd uhd player, a tv box, a tv that supports dvhe.07.
